WISeKey Receives One of the First French National Cybersecurity Agency's security Visa LabelsWISeKey Receives One of the First French National Cybersecurity Agency's security Visa Labels This new cybersecurity reward is an official recognition of WISeKey's dedication to IoT security, in particular with its certified secure microcontrollers Paris, France - Geneva, Switzerland - July 4, 2018: WISeKey International Holding Ltd (WIHN.SW, OTTCQX: WIKYY) ("WISeKey"), a Swiss based cybersecurity and IoT company, today announced that on June 21, 2018 it received from the French National Cybersecurity Agency (ANSSI), one of the first security Visas for the Common Criteria security certification of its MS6001 Rev. E secure microcontroller (certification report ANSSI-CC-2018/02). According to a research published in September 2017 by Accenture and the Ponemon Institute, the average cost of cybercrime globally in 2016 climbed to $11.7 million per organization, a 23 percent increase from $9.5 million reported a year earlier, representing a staggering 62 percent increase over the last five years. To complement these figures, a recent Gartner Inc. survey found that nearly 20 percent of organizations observed at least one IoT-based attack in the past three years. To protect against those threats Gartner forecasts that worldwide spending on IoT security will reach $1.5 billion in 2018, a 28 percent increase from 2017 spending of $1.2 billion. The security Visas issued by ANSSI allow to easily identify reliable cyber security solutions that are recognized as such following an evaluation performed in accordance with rigorous and approved methods by licensed evaluation laboratories. This evaluation involves in-depth conformity analysis and penetration testing to make sure that the solutions are compliant with the targeted security need. A security Visa takes the form of a certification or qualification, depending on the context and the need. Security Visas are a guarantee of security for the users.
